Understanding Common Login Issues

Many factors can contribute to problems when attempting to access your Luckystar account. One of the most frequent causes is simply an incorrect username or password. It’s surprisingly common to mistype credentials, especially on mobile devices or when using auto-fill features that may have stored outdated information. Another common problem arises when password resets are not properly completed or the new password doesn't meet the platform's security requirements. These requirements often include a minimum length, a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. Furthermore, browser-related issues, such as outdated caches or conflicting extensions, can interfere with the login process. Finally, technical issues on the Luckystar server side, although infrequent, can also temporarily prevent users from logging in.

Troubleshooting Incorrect Credentials

If you suspect you’re entering the wrong password, the first step is to utilize the “Forgot Password” or “Reset Password” option. This typically involves entering the email address associated with your account, after which Luckystar will send you an email with instructions on how to create a new password. Always check your spam or junk folder if you don’t receive the email within a few minutes. When creating a new password, choose a strong and unique combination that you haven't used on other websites. It’s best practice to avoid using easily guessable information, such as your birthday or pet’s name. If you've tried resetting your password multiple times and are still unable to log in, it is advisable to contact Luckystar support directly.

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) and Security

Implementing two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of security to your Luckystar account. 2FA requires you to provide a second form of verification, such as a code generated by an authenticator app on your smartphone, in addition to your password. This makes it significantly more difficult for unauthorized individuals to gain access to your account, even if they manage to obtain your password. Luckystar may support various 2FA methods, including SMS-based verification, authenticator apps like Google Authenticator or Authy, and potentially hardware security keys. Enabling 2FA is a highly recommended security measure to protect your account from potential breaches and ensure your personal information remains secure. It’s a proactive measure that can dramatically reduce the risk of unauthorized access.

Diagnosing Browser and Device Conflicts

Browser extensions can sometimes interfere with website functionality, causing login issues or other errors. Try disabling all extensions and then attempting to log in again. If the problem is resolved, you can re-enable extensions one by one to identify the culprit. Similarly, conflicting software on your device, such as firewalls or antivirus programs, could be blocking access to the Luckystar platform. Temporarily disabling these programs (with caution) can help determine if they are contributing to the issue. Finally, ensure your device’s date and time settings are accurate, as incorrect settings can sometimes cause security certificate errors and prevent you from logging in.
